Gary Sinise is an American actor, director, and humanitarian known for his versatile performances across film, television, and theater. He first gained widespread recognition for his role as Lt. Dan Taylor in the 1994 film “Forrest Gump,” for which he received an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actor. Sinise went on to star in numerous successful films, including “Apollo 13,” “The Green Mile,” and “Ransom.” In addition to his acting career, Sinise is also a talented director, having directed episodes of hit television shows like “CSI: NY” and “Criminal Minds.” Beyond his artistic endeavors, Sinise is also a dedicated philanthropist, particularly in support of military veterans and their families. He co-founded the Gary Sinise Foundation, a nonprofit organization that provides support and resources to veterans, first responders, and their loved ones. Sinise has received numerous awards for his humanitarian work, including the Presidential Citizens Medal, the Bob Hope Award for Excellence in Entertainment, and the Spirit of Hope Award. Early Life and Career


Gary Sinise, born in Blue Island, Illinois in 1955, developed a passion for acting at a young age. He began his career in the entertainment industry by co-founding the Steppenwolf Theatre Company in Chicago in 1974. His talent and dedication to his craft quickly gained recognition, leading him to land various roles in both film and television. Sinise’s breakthrough role came in the 1994 film “Forrest Gump,” where he portrayed Lieutenant Dan Taylor, a role that earned him critical acclaim and an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actor.

Humanitarian Work and Philanthropy


Aside from his successful acting career, Gary Sinise is also known for his philanthropic endeavors. He is a passionate advocate for veterans and active-duty military personnel, founding the Gary Sinise Foundation in 2011 to support and honor America’s defenders, veterans, first responders, and their families. The foundation provides a wide range of programs and services, including financial assistance, mental health support, and housing initiatives for veterans in need. Sinise’s dedication to giving back to those who have served their country has earned him numerous accolades and recognition for his humanitarian work.
